October 8, 2010
Slugs Upset Leopards

Slug Logo
LA VERNE , CA --
UC Santa Cruz Women’s Volleyball team defeated the University of La Verne on Friday night. The Slug’s won in five games 25-12, 24-26, 25-19, 19-25, and 15-13. This win moves the Slug’s overall record to 13-7.

Sophomore Katherine Grow led the slugs with 21 kills, fallowed by Sophomore Opposite Hitter Elizabeth Trambley with 12 kills. Junior Setter Alyssa Trakes contributed 47 assists and Sophomore Libero Jaime Weber had 20 digs for the match.

Game one the Slugs came out with fire and the Leopards were unable to respond. In game two both teams would not give up any ground but the aggressive serving game of the Leopards helped them slip by.

Game three was close but aggressive blocking from Junior Middle Blocker Helen Milne helped the Slugs gain the upper hand.

Game four was another nail biter. The Leopards rallied and put together a great come back to edge out the Slugs. Game five was an up and down battle with the match winning kill going to Outside Hitter Katherine Grow.

The Slug’s play their next match Saturday morning in La Verne against Chapman University. The match is set to start at 11:30 am.
